A Brief Overview
The Advanced Practice Provider is responsible for providing quality care for patients and increasing patient access and satisfaction. Standard tasks to be performed by a NP/PA as specified by the Ohio State Board of Medicine and UH entity specific Medical Bylaws:
What you will do

This is a full-time, day shift position; Monday through Friday. In this role you will care for patients primarily in the Inpatient setting, but will spending 10-20% of the time in the Outpatient setting managing discharged hospital patients. 

·        Initiates and maintains positive relationships w/pts/customers (10%)

·        Initiates and maintains positive relationships w/co-workers (10%)

·        Takes responsibility for self-development and supports a learning environment (10%)

·        Displays commitment to the mission of the hospital and its values (10%)

·        Performs patient assessment and assigns diagnosis based on recorded assessment data and current scientific and current research (20%)

·        Establishes plan of care and implements interventions in accordance w/carepaths, protocols, and standards of care and current research (15%)

·        Collaborates w/other health care providers in an interdisciplinary approach to provide care to the patient and family (5%)

·        Contributes to the educational development of staff, patients, family and self (5%)

·        Demonstrates progressive leadership and effective management (5%)

·        Provides education through role modeling and in-services to meet identified learning needs and to promote professionalism (5%)

·        Advances own professional development through self-directed learning, continuing education and participation in peer review (5%)

About University Hospitals

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

For more than 155 years, University Hospitals has been on a mission to heal, teach and discover. As a renowned academic medical center and community hospital network, we’ve expanded across Northeast Ohio to deliver what matters most to our patients: personalized, compassionate care; medical discovery and breakthroughs; and high-quality, affordable care close to home.
